Charge
DWI - First Offense
Location
Denton County, CCC5
Allegations
After parking and walking away from the vehicle, the client was contacted in a commercial area and arrested for DWI. We secured surveillance showing the client arriving, exiting, and remaining away from the truck, with no officer or witness who could place intoxication at the time of driving. We highlighted missing body camera footage, questioned the officer’s field test qualifications, and noted quality control issues with the blood lab, which was drawn under a warrant later. Confronted with these weaknesses, the state reduced the case to a lesser charge with straight probation.
Result
Charges Reduced
Charge
DWI - First Offense
Location
Atascosa County, CCL
Allegations
Following a traffic stop, the client performed field sobriety tests, blew on a roadside device, and later provided a breath sample at the jail. Our team quickly obtained the dashcam video, police reports, and breath test records. We reviewed the HGN, walk-and-turn, and one-leg stand administration, and scrutinized the breath testing paperwork for procedural issues. Leveraging our workup and mitigation about the client's future goals, we pressed for a resolution that avoided a conviction. The state agreed to pre-trial diversion.
Result
Pre-Trial Diversion

Charge
Aggravated Assault with a Deadly Weapon
Location
Travis County, 460th District Court
Allegations
Officers responded to a domestic dispute and arrested our client for aggravated assault with a deadly weapon after the other person alleged a knife was involved. Body camera footage showed the client visibly shaken inside the home with signs of injury and distress, yet little investigation was done before the arrest. We compiled the videos, prior police reports reflecting the complainant's intoxication and volatility, an audio recording capturing the complainant's aggression, and corroborating statements from third parties. Faced with those credibility issues and a noncooperative complainant, the state dismissed the case.
Result
Case Dismissed

Charge
DWI - First Offense
Location
Brazoria County, CC2
Allegations
After a beach gathering, the client drove along sand, missed an exit, and struck a parked vehicle. No injuries were reported at the scene. Officers noted possible intoxication, conducted the eye-tracking test, and later obtained a consensual blood draw. We secured the videos and reports, highlighting the crash with airbag deployment, the unstable surface where evaluations occurred, and the absence of standardized walk-and-turn or one-leg tests. Using those points and holding the state to its proof on the blood, we negotiated deferred probation.
Result
Deferred Adjudication
Charge
Possession of a Controlled Substance (Third-Degree Felony)
Location
Travis County, 427th District Court
Allegations
The client was detained after a traffic stop for a broken headlight at a convenience store. Two passengers produced fake IDs, prompting officers to pull everyone out and search the car. Our client was a passenger. Officers said they found a pipe and suspected narcotics in a black bag that belonged to the client, who denied any knowledge and explained others regularly used the vehicle. We obtained dash and bodycam footage and the lab records, and challenged the basis for the search and proof of knowing possession. Facing those issues and our readiness to litigate, the prosecution dismissed the case.
Result
Case Dismissed
